Valuation of biological resources includes the process of deriving a monetary value to the things that are not sold in the market. Examples are the value given to fuelwood gathered in the forest, water filtration provided in a wetland or biological resource that may supply new medicines in the future. Valuation is essential for a "social cost- benefit" analysis of biodiversity (i.e. analyzing the costs and benefits of maintaining biodiversity for a society), and is linked to "environmental accounting" which means the modification of national accounts to take into consideration the economic role of the environment. Many countries in the world are now attempting this. It is believed that over 25 countries have experimented with environmental accounting over the past 20 years and a few European countries have already set up physical accounting systems that are routinely complied and applied to economic and environmental policy making. Biodiversity valuation can contribute to constructing environmental accounts at the national level.
